Output 39d53dd9ac053d63ef26da03e4ec70c774585340f7a753835aadc94aaf4ab065:0

value
86629
script pubkey
OP_0 OP_PUSHBYTES_20 6bc709cc667e6569d015e94e26cb1bc2ed9c9cd9
address
bc1qd0rsnnrx0ejkn5q4a98zdjcmctkee8xe5re43t
transaction
39d53dd9ac053d63ef26da03e4ec70c774585340f7a753835aadc94aaf4ab065
spent
true